Thursday 5pm Weather 01-27-11

By: horace brown
Updated: January 27, 2011
watch video
High temperatures this weekend will be in the upper 60s Friday and Saturday and middle 60s on Sunday.  Skies will be sunny to mostly sunny and winds light.  We will have a slight chance for rain in the mountains and Trans Pecos area.  Cooler temperatures can be expected Monday and even colder air on Tuesday with a chance for a rain snow mix.
